Time to wait

Many people choose private clinics because of the long waiting time for NHS ADHD assessments. However, this option is not without risk. BBC Panorama reported that many private clinics rush their assessments and prescribe powerful medications for long-term use. Some clinics do not consider the medical history of patients or potential adverse effects. The report said that a few private clinics had ignored National Institute for Health and Care Excellence guidelines on the treatment of ADHD.

Insurance

If you have health insurance coverage through a private company and you have the option to pay for a private psychiatrist to assess and treat your ADHD symptoms. You should be aware of the limitations to coverage. If you're not insured you can still get a diagnosis by asking your GP to refer you to a psychiatrist who specialises in ADHD. It will cost you more however there will be shorter waiting times. Psychologists are also able to help with co-morbidities, such as anxiety and depression, which are common in ADHD.

The price of a private assessment will vary from one service to another, and some require the submission of a GP referral letter while others don't. Before booking, inquire whether there is a GP referral is required. If they require a referral, make sure to obtain one as soon as you can. Examine the terms and conditions in your insurance policy to determine if they will cover private appointments.

It is crucial to receive an ADHD diagnosis however, the process may be lengthy. Waiting for an NHS appointment is difficult and stressful for many people. Many private companies are jumping into the picture to assist. This is a great idea, however, you must keep in mind that a psychiatrist cannot treat your symptoms until you've received a formal diagnose.

This is Money has contacted several private insurers to find out whether they provide ADHD assessments. So far, Aviva and Vitality have both confirmed that they don't pay for this kind of treatment. Bupa however, claims it covers diagnostic tests for mental disorders when they are suspected.
